US ZIP Code 27501 Population by Race & Ethnicity
| Race / Ethnicity | Population | Percentage |
|---|---|---|
| White (Non-Hispanic) | 15,672 | 63.2% |
| Hispanic or Latino | 4,718 | 19.0% |
| Black / African American | 3,044 | 12.3% |
| Two or More Races | 990 | 4.0% |
| Asian | 171 | 0.7% |
| Native American | 149 | 0.6% |
| Other Race | 58 | 0.2% |
| Pacific Islander | 4 | 0.0% |
